Get started3 Church Street is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Barlborough, Chesterfield, Chesterfield (S43 4ER). It has a recorded floor area of 113 m² (around 1216 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band C. It is a listed building, which means external alterations are tightly controlled but it may qualify for heritage tax reliefs. Period features are noted in the property record. The home occupies a cul-de-sac position. The latest certificate (February 2018) shows an E (score 47),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 83), a 3-band jump.
At 113 m² the property is well over the postcode median (65 m² across 6 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Today's modelled estimate of £249,000 is 18.6% above the 2022 sale price. Most recent transfer: February 2022 at £210,000.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end. One historical planning record sits against the property in 2023.
